Over 450 of the egg industry鈥檚 leaders and decision makers from across the world are meeting this week in London, for the International Egg Commission鈥檚 Annual Marketing and Production Conference.
IEC Chair, Joanne Ivy (far left) welcomes conference delegates Alison Bone (BFREPA), Duncan Priestner (NFU Poultry Council) and Robert Gooch (BFREPA Director of Policy)
This IEC conference is the most important event in the international egg industry鈥檚 calendar.
During the next four days, conference delegates will hear from a truly outstanding line-up of speakers, including Sir Terry Leahy, the world renowned former Chief Executive of Tesco, Dr Chris Brown from Walmart鈥檚 Asda, and Jorge Rueda, from Mexico鈥檚 Ministry of Agriculture.
IEC Chair, Joanne Ivy, hosted a Welcome Reception on Sunday evening at the Grosvenor House Hotel, to officially open the IEC London 2012 conference.
During the conference, speakers and delegates will discuss the latest issues, trends and developments affecting the global egg industry, including:
路 Sustainable Consumption;
路 Environmental footprint of eggs;
路 The impact of Avian Influenza in Mexico;
路 The impact of the EU animal welfare directive;
路 Latest research into egg nutrition.
